How To Choose The Best Curl Defining Products For 4C Hair
Selecting a curl definer for 4C hair goes beyond grabbing the first gel on the shelf. The texture’s tight coils and high shrinkage rate demand specific characteristics that other curl types don’t require. Here are the three most important factors.
Hold Strength vs. Flexibility
A cast that is too hard leads to flaking and breakage when the hair moves. The ideal product forms a flexible, scrunchable cast that elongates the curl without locking it in a stiff shell. Look for formulations using film-formers like aloe vera or agave nectar combined with soft-hold polymers. These allow the curl to retain its shape while the hair stays pliable and touchable throughout the day.
Anti-Shrinkage & Elongation
4C hair can shrink by up to 75 percent of its actual length, so a defining product must contain ingredients that weigh the hair down just enough to counter that. Humectants like hyaluronic serum, mango seed butter, or glycerin attract moisture and help stretch the strand. Products that list “anti-shrinkage” as a specific benefit often provide the necessary balance of moisture and weight without causing limp, flat curls.
Slip & Moisture Retention
Applying a defining product on 4C hair requires slip—the ability to glide through the hair without friction. Slip reduces breakage during twisting and braiding. Creams and custards with butters (shea, mango) or plant extracts like Irish moss and bamboo provide this glide while sealing in moisture. A product with low slip forces you to tug, which leads to mechanical damage over time.
